Description:
Our client is looking for a Network Technician. The Network Technician supports the County's network, voice and communications infrastructure in a multi-site and multi-partner environment. Performs analysis, implementation, support, maintenance and monitoring of these systems while following County standards. Provides project management for small to mid-size projects.
Tasks/Responsibilities
Plan, procure, implement, support, maintain, monitor and troubleshoot the County's overall network infrastructure including wireless, internet, data, voice, and video communications.
Implement and maintain security for all networks
Monitor systems to ensure proper performance. Troubleshoot and repair issues
Serve as project leader of small to mid-size network related projects.
Write technical specifications, coordinate resources and training, plan and perform installations and create documentation.
Document systems, configurations, inventory, licenses, and procedures. Create training materials for IT staff and end users.
Provide mentoring and technical support to other IT staff members.
Consult with users to recommend ways IT can help them reach their goals in a cost effective manner.
Assist in the development of IT controls, processes, standards, policies and procedures.
Backup the Network Engineers, Network Technicians, System Engineers and System Technicians
